Android 系统的创建:从概念到现实90
Android,作为当今最流行的移动操作系统,其诞生背后的历程是一段非凡的技术创新之旅。本文将深入探讨 Android 的创建过程,从其概念萌芽到成为全球数十亿设备的动力。
起源:一个“神奇的小东西”
2003 年,安迪鲁宾和里奇迈纳在寻找一种方法来连接分散的个人计算机和设备。他们构想了一个基于 Java 的嵌入式操作系统,可以为当时新兴的智能手机提供动力。最初被称为 Android,这个“神奇的小东西”旨在成为一个开放、灵活且可定制的软件平台。
开源基金会的成立
2005 年,谷歌收购了 Android,并成立了开放手机联盟 (OHA)——一个致力于开发和推广 Android 操作系统的开源联盟。OHA 由谷歌、三星、HTC、摩托罗拉和索尼等主要技术公司组成,共同构建 Android 系统的基础设施。
Android 1.0 的发布
2008 年,第一款搭载 Android 1.0 的智能手机发布。这款操作系统以其直观的触控界面、应用程序下载能力和多任务处理功能而引起轰动。尽管早期版本存在一些缺点,但 Android 的潜力显而易见。
持续的演变和更新
从 Android 1.0 开始,该操作系统经历了一系列重大更新,每个更新都带来了新的功能和改进。Android 2.0“Froyo”引入应用程序内购买和 Adobe Flash 支持;而 Android 4.0“Ice Cream Sandwich”则统一了平板电脑和智能手机的界面。Android 5.0“Lollipop”以其 Material Design 语言、改进的通知系统和 64 位处理器支持而闻名。
碎片化的挑战
随着 Android 的普及,一个日益严重的挑战出现了:碎片化。由于制造商和运营商定制 Android 系统,导致设备和软件版本之间出现重大差异。这给开发者和用户带来了维护和兼容性问题。
控制碎片化的策略
为了解决碎片化问题,谷歌实施了多项策略。他们发布了 Android 兼容性定义文档 (CDD),这有助于标准化 Android 设备的功能和特性。此外,他们还推出了 Nexus 设备系列,旨在提供纯净的 Android 体验。谷歌还通过提供频繁的更新和安全补丁来努力缩小软件版本之间的差距。
第三方开发人员社区的兴起
Android 的开源本质催生了一个充满活力的第三方开发人员社区。开发者创建了数百万个应用程序、工具和自定义 ROM,进一步扩展了 Android 的功能和可能性。开发者社区的贡献对于 Android 生态系统的蓬勃发展至关重要。
Android 的影响
Android 对移动技术产生了深远的影响。它使智能手机和设备变得更加负担得起和易于使用,从而使移动计算普及化。Android 也为开发者提供了创造创新应用程序和服务的平台,创造了一个繁荣的应用程序经济。此外,Android 的开源性质促进了技术的进步和协作。
Android 的创建是一个非凡的旅程,融合了创新、协作和持续发展。从一个“神奇的小东西”到全球数十亿设备的动力,Android 已经成为移动计算领域不可或缺的一部分。它的开源性质、强大的开发者社区和不断演变的性质确保了 Android 将继续塑造移动技术的未来。
2024-10-31